About the name Rajas
Rajas is a boy's name of Sanskrit origin, most commonly given in Hindu families and popular in North & Central India. It carries the meaning “Energy; passion.”
Spoken aloud it is Ra·jas — 2 syllables. Rajas is scarce in Indian public population records. Those cover adults, so names popular with today's newborns often score low here.
